How To Unlock The MORS in 2026
First things first—you need to get your hands on this beauty. The unlock method has stayed consistent, which is great for new players jumping in.

Location: Sector C12 of the Battle Pass (still the same spot as previous seasons)
Token Cost: 15 Battle Pass Tokens minimum
Weapon Levels: 19 total levels to max out
Special Attachment: Aftermarket barrel with charge shot mechanic (unlocked at max rank with 100 one-hit kills)
Pro tip from my grinding sessions: if you're focused solely on the MORS, you can rush straight to Sector C12. The 15-token requirement means you'll need to complete about half of the preceding sectors first. Plan your token spending wisely! The aftermarket barrel is absolutely worth the grind—that charge shot mechanic changes how you approach certain engagements.
The Ultimate MORS Quickscope Build for 2026
Okay, let's get to the good stuff. After extensive testing in the current meta, here's the build that's been absolutely slaying for me:
| Attachment Slot | Choice | Why It Works |
|---|---|---|
| Optic | Mors Dot Sight | Replaces high-zoom scope with red dot for faster ADS |
| Barrel | Downfall Light Barrel | Massive ADS and movement speed boost |
| Rear Grip | OP-980 Grip | Improves ADS speed and aim walking steadiness |
| Bolt | Quick Bolt | Faster rechambering between shots |
| Stock | Superlite-90 Stock | Essentially 'no stock' attachment for max mobility |
Why This Combo Works in 2026:
• ADS Speed: 387ms (insanely fast for a sniper)
• One-Hit Kill Zone: Torso and above
• Playstyle: Aggressive quickscoping
• Trade-off: Reduced flinch resistance (you miss, you lose)
Let me break down the philosophy here. The MORS Dot Sight completely changes how this weapon handles. That high-zoom scope? Gone. What you get instead is a clean red dot that lets you acquire targets lightning fast. Pair this with the Superlite-90 Stock—which is basically the MORS version of running no stock—and your mobility goes through the roof.
The Downfall Light Barrel and OP-980 Grip work together to push your ADS speed down to that magical 387ms threshold. This is where the MORS truly shines. You can challenge at almost any engagement range and come out on top if your shot is accurate.
Important Note: If you're running the Mag Holster perk (which I'll discuss in loadouts), you can skip the Quick Bolt. The rechamber speed boost becomes redundant. Personally, I prefer having it for those moments when you need a quick follow-up shot.
Complete Loadout Synergy for 2026
A great weapon needs a great loadout. Here's what I've been running that complements the MORS perfectly:
Perk Setup:
🎽 Vest: Compression Carrier (gives you Quick-Fix effect from MW2)
🧤 Gloves: Quick-Grip Gloves (instant weapon swap when needed)
👟 Boots: Covert Sneakers (silent movement is crucial)
🎭 Gear: Ghost (stay off enemy radar)
Equipment Choices:
🗡️ Lethal: Throwing Knife (versatile one-hit kill option)
🔫 Secondary: Renetti or WSP Stinger (for close-quarters emergencies)
This loadout is all about stealth and aggression. The Compression Carrier gives you that sweet health regeneration after kills—perfect for staying in the fight during multi-kill streaks. Ghost and Covert Sneakers keep you hidden from both radar and audio detection. Quick-Grip Gloves? Absolute lifesaver when someone rushes you and the MORS isn't the right tool for the job.
Since we're using the Compression Carrier (which sacrifices Tactical and Field Upgrade slots), we only have the Lethal to work with. Throwing Knives have remained meta for good reason—they work as both ranged finishers and quick melee attacks. For secondary, I alternate between the Renetti for its burst potential and the WSP Stinger for pure close-range dominance.
Advanced Tips & 2026 Meta Considerations
After months with this setup, here are some insights you won't find in the basic stats:
Movement is Key: With this build, you're not a traditional sniper. You're a mobile threat that happens to have a one-hit kill weapon. Use that mobility! Slide-canceling into quickscopes, jumping around corners—these movement techniques separate good MORS users from great ones.
Map Awareness: The reduced flinch resistance means you CANNOT afford to be caught off-guard. Always position yourself with an escape route. If you miss that first shot, disengage immediately unless you're confident in your secondary.
The Charge Shot Barrel: Once you unlock it, experiment! The charge shot mechanic isn't always necessary, but on larger maps or against armored targets in Warzone, it can be a game-changer. It does change your timing though, so practice in private matches first.
Warzone Adaptation: This build works surprisingly well in Warzone too, but consider swapping the optic for something with more zoom on larger maps. The core attachment philosophy remains the same—maximize ADS speed while maintaining one-hit kill potential.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
I've seen plenty of players try to run the MORS and fail miserably. Here's what NOT to do:
❌ Trying to use it like a traditional sniper (you'll get outgunned by Longbow users)
❌ Ignoring the flinch resistance penalty (you WILL lose gunfights if you trade shots)
❌ Forgetting to use your secondary (the Quick-Grip Gloves are there for a reason!)
❌ Staying scoped in for too long (this isn't a camping weapon)
